I have enabled all the things necessary for WOL which works fine for sleep or hibernate. When I shutdown my computer in Windows via Start > Power > Shutdown the computer will not work with WOL, however if I shutdown using the physical power button on the front of my tower (Not holding down, just normal quick press) it will work with WOL. I have disabled fast boot, power saving etc and setting in BIOS. This is using a network PCIE card.

Thanks for any help possible.

PC Specs:
Asus M5A99FX PRO R2.0
Network Card: TP-LINK TG-3468
OS: Windows 10 Pro

Check if ethernet led is on when you shutdown the PC.

If it is not then -

1. Update network adapter driver

2. Right Click This PC > Manage > Device Manager >Network Adapters > Double Clicked on motherboard network adapter > Advanced tab > Enable "Shutdown Wake ON LAN"

Check if ethernet led is on when you shutdown the PC.

Hopefully, it will be turned on now and you will be good to go.
